"Let down by lack of diagnosis"

About: King's Mill Hospital / Gynaecology

(as the patient),

I have been a gynae outpatient for nearly two years for abnormal uterine bleeding and chronic pelvic pain. I have had a scan, a colposcopy, a laparoscopy and multiple examinations under the care of two different consultants for some reason.

Up to now no cause has been found for the on-going chronic pain which has affected every aspect of my life, caused severe depression and ended my career.

Following a complaint to PALS I finally met my consultant in person. I found them to be condescending and they basically said that they could find no cause for my pain and they would not continue to investigate any further now my only option is to go to the pain clinic and to take tranexamic acid and mefanemic acid to reduce the impact that my menstruation has on the pelvic pain.

I feel that the gynaecology team at this hospital are very close-minded and will not even investigate the possibility of pelvic congestion as it is difficult to diagnose and treat. This syndrome has been known about for nearly 150 years but as it is so difficult to diagnose few NHS consultants are willing to accept it as a viable diagnosis, instead they prefer to leave me suffering in pain for what is likely to be countless years.

I left the consultation feeling like a hypochondriac and utterly let down.

I will never use this service again.
